Yet no comment from them about what being a "provider" under PRISM entails.

* "In addition, Apple has never worked with any government agency from any country to create a “back door” in any of our products or services."

If Apple provides an interface to request user-data to law enforcement / NSA, that's not a back door in the product or the service.

* "We have also never allowed any government access to our servers. And we never will."

If they provide user-data after being served with a warrant (possibly through email or to their legal department), their servers were never accessed, yet the data was provided.

It's always interesting to read what is and isn't said. Word games, I swear.

But "iCloud does not encrypt data stored on IMAP mail servers" or Notes http://support.apple.com/kb/HT4865

"Last Modified: Dec 12, 2013".

That December 2013 page is linked to from today's announcement, under "Learn more about iCloud security." See: http://www.apple.com/privacy/privacy-built-in/

Also note that today's announcement says Mail and Notes are "encrypted in transit" only. In other words the December 2013 page remains current.

I'm very skeptical that traditional screen-lock passcodes offer useful protection for the average person. Most people still choose to use 4-digit passcodes for convenience, leaving exhaustive key search [1] well within the reach of even very small attackers.

Are these four-digit passcodes being used to derive encryption keys? If so, I'd like to hear where the additional entropy comes from. There's no use encrypting things with a 128-bit key when the effective entropy of the key is really only ~12.3 bits.

I'm sure the engineers at Apple would not have overlooked this; it would be great to hear more about the specifics.

[1] especially if the attacker can download encrypted data and try an infinite number of times (instead of e.g. typing the passcode on the phone or hitting the iCloud servers)

>If they provide user-data after being served with a warrant their servers were never accessed, yet the data was provided.

Yes, that's true. But if you run an email service that's based in Cupertino, what do you do when served with a lawful search warrant or wiretap order? Say "no," and be found in contempt of court and have all your servers carted away by some men in black so they can find the file they're looking for?

There are a few ways around this. One is not to permanently store warrant-worthy user data (Snapchat, Wickr, etc.). Another is end-to-end encryption (original version of Hushmail), though key distribution and UX become problems. A third is to move your servers to Switzerland, though then you get served with process from the Swiss authorities instead of FBIDHSDEAetc.

Apple has taken none of these steps. Assume our hypothetical Cupertino-based email service has not either. What do you do when the Feds show up with a lawful order?
